Cards For A Cause: Calgary

Calgary, Alberta
Joined 26 décembre 2025
Cards For A Cause is a nonprofit organization created by two high school students. Our goal is to create community and spark happiness in times of stress and isolation, through cards. We are planning to involve senior homes, homeless shelters, front-line workers, and schools. Students from schools will be given the opportunity to write cards for the residents and workers of senior homes and homeless shelters and front-line workers. Students can leave their contact information for the possibility of receiving a card back.

Carewest Innovative Health Care

Calgary, Alberta
Joined 26 décembre 2025
At Carewest, we strive to be forward thinking and approach things differently in the hopes of bringing value to our residents, clients, volunteers and staff. We continually ask ourselves: “how can we do this better?” New ideas and fresh thinking have been our cornerstone, helping take us from where we were more than half a century ago to the progressive health care organization we are today. We believe as strongly in responsiveness, evolution and growth as we do in our, history, foundation and experience. As Calgary’s largest public care provider of its kind and one of the largest in Canada, Carewest operates 14 locations aimed at helping people live more independent lives. Our spectrum of care is available to adults of all ages and includes long-term care, rehabilitation and recovery services, and community programs and services. We pride ourselves on our ability to change with the community’s needs and we do our best to predict what those needs may be in the future. Innovative thinking brought us here – imagine where it can take us.

Children's International Summer Villages Association

Calgary, Alberta
Joined 26 décembre 2025
CISV is an international, nonprofit, nondenominational organization called Children’s International Summer Villages (www.cisvcalgary.com), in which we promote peace through multicultural summer camps. Next July, our chapter will be hosting a summer camp called a Village. During this month, twelve delegations of 11 year olds along with their leaders from all over the world will live together while participating in activities to help build lasting international friendships and multicultural understanding. We are looking for volunteer staff to help run our program.

Chinook Country Historical Society

Calgary, Alberta
Joined 26 décembre 2025
The Chinook Country Historical Society is the local Chapter of the Historical Society. We are a group of people dedicated to promoting a greater understanding of Canadian and Alberta history in Chinook Country for people of all ages. Organized in 1958 and incorporated in 1993, the CCHS covers the region from Olds to Nanton and from the BC border to the Saskatchewan border.
